After three episodes, I feel like I can safely say that there is a discernible difference in web comics from regular 'zine fare... unsurprisingly it is editorial oversight...
This author is left to their own devices in crafting a bare-bones shounen tournament arc from the get-go, and it shows. Random power ups, characters having flashy fights will basically no build up of strategies or techniques until they happen... there is a reason the formula exists... giving characters time to develop and grow a bit adds emotional attachment for the audience before you throw the two battling tops into the arena and see which falls over first. The animation, while flashy isn't quiiiite sakuga enough to impress in this case.
Comparisons to Tower of God are likely due to the source genre (Korean Webcomics), but the similarities really end there.
I can't recommend this, but some of the fight compilation videos might be worth a watch in the future...
